草庐IT

python - 您自己的 GUI 中的 Matplotlib 动画

我正在用Python编写软件。我需要将Matplotlib时间动画嵌入到自制的GUI中。以下是关于它们的更多详细信息:1.图形界面GUI也是用Python编写的,使用PyQt4库。我的GUI与您可以在网上找到的常见GUI没有太大区别。我只是子类化QtGui.QMainWindow并添加一些按钮、布局、...2.动画Matplotlib动画基于animation.TimedAnimation类。这是动画的代码:importnumpyasnpimportmatplotlib.pyplotaspltfrommatplotlib.linesimportLine2Dimportmatplotli

python - 在哪里可以找到 Python 的 GUI 设计器?

按照目前的情况,这个问题不适合我们的问答形式。我们希望答案得到事实、引用或专业知识的支持,但这个问题可能会引发辩论、争论、投票或扩展讨论。如果您觉得这个问题可以改进并可能重新打开,visitthehelpcenter指导。关闭10年前。有谁知道像Glade这样的python的GUI设计器,但用于windows?

python - 使用外部 GUI 库在 Autodesk Maya 中制作用户界面

我在AutodeskMaya中开发工具。我构建的许多工具都有简单的窗口GUI供动画师和建模师使用。这些GUI通常包含您通常希望在任何基本窗口中看到的内容;标签、列表、菜单、按钮、文本字段等。但是,您可以使用可用工具构建的UI的复杂性存在限制,特别是在可用小部件的类型方面。我有兴趣使用一些更高级的wxPython小部件,例如ListView(网格)、树等。这将涉及使用完整的wxFrame(窗口)来显示整个UI,这实际上意味着该窗口将不再与Maya绑定(bind)。不会破坏交易,但这意味着当Maya最小化时,窗口不会随之最小化。我之前用tkinter作为测试尝试过类似的东西,但发现它需要一

python - 用于 Snow Leopard(64 位)的漂亮 Python GUI 工具包

我正在寻找一个GUI工具包/框架来创建在MacSnowLeopard和其他系统(Windows、Linux)上运行的应用程序。交易破坏者:基于X11非原生小部件32位/碳糟糕的Mac外观和感觉据我所知,Tkinter运行X11,wxWidgets和PyQT不运行64位。有什么好看的Mac应用程序可用吗?[编辑]http://wiki.python.org/moin/GuiProgramming列出了很多不可用的东西,但有一些有趣的东西。Lucid...敲响了警钟,但该站点与Python无关。PyGUI,看起来像一个很酷的单人项目,就像uxpython一样。看来QT、WX、TK真的是大佬

python - PyGTK 阻塞非 GUI 线程

我想用PyGTK解决线程错误。到目前为止我有这段代码:#!/usr/bin/pythonimportpygtkpygtk.require('2.0')importgtkimportthreadingfromtimeimportsleepclassSomeNonGUIThread(threading.Thread):def__init__(self,tid):super(SomeNonGUIThread,self).__init__()self.tid=tiddefrun(self):whileTrue:print"Client#%d"%self.tidsleep(0.5)classAp

python - 在在线IDE上使用Python的GUI?

我有一个关于运行GUI的问题。很遗憾,我运行的是一个Chrome操作系统,这意味着我没有选择使用和运行在线IDE中的代码。我想知道是否有可能从在线IDE运行一个GUI包,比如tkinter或wxwidgets?有什么办法吗?我通常使用的主要IDE是Cloud9。 最佳答案 答案可能是否定的。像tkinter和wxwidgets这样的包被写到操作系统较低级别的接口上。像cloud9这样的Web界面将无法与这些库进行交互以显示在chrome操作系统中,因为它们必须将直接的用户界面调用转换为HTML以显示在浏览器中。

python - 关闭 WxPython GUI 的转义键

我正在开发一个相当简单的wxpythonGUI,并且希望能够使用转义键关闭窗口。现在我只有一个执行sys.exit(0)的关闭按钮,但我想要转义键来执行此操作。有谁知道这样做的方法吗?importwin32clipboardimportwxfromtimeimportsleepimportsysclassMainFrame(wx.Frame):def__init__(self,title):wx.Frame.__init__(self,None,title="-RRESIRounder-",pos=(0,0),size=(210,160))panel=Panel(self)icon=w

python - 如何从正在运行的 QThread 向启动它的 PyQt Gui 发出信号?

我正在尝试了解如何使用从Qthread发回启动的Gui界面的信号。设置:我有一个过程(模拟)需要几乎无限期地运行(或至少运行很长一段时间)。在运行时,它会执行各种计算,并且必须发送一些结果返回到GUI,它将实时适本地显示它们。我在GUI中使用PyQt。我最初尝试使用python的线程模块,然后在阅读了SO和其他地方的几篇文章后切换到QThreads。根据Qt博客上的这篇文章You'redoingitwrong,使用QThread的首选方法是创建一个QObject,然后将其移动到Qthread。所以我听从了PyQt中使用QThread的后台线程中的建议”>这个SO问题并尝试了一个简单的测

python - pygtk 如何在我的 pygtk GUI 中嵌入外部应用程序

我正在设计一个pygtkGUI并想在其中嵌入一个外部应用程序。有人知道如何做到这一点吗? 最佳答案 这取决于您要嵌入的应用程序,但如果另一个应用程序是GTK应用程序(或支持XEMBED协议(protocol)的应用程序),您应该可以使用gtk.Plug来完成此操作和gtk.Socket.PyGTK教程中有一节解释了如何执行此操作:http://www.pygtk.org/pygtk2tutorial/sec-PlugsAndSockets.html 关于python-pygtk如何在我的

c++ - 制作 map 编辑器的语言/GUI库

我正在为我开发的应用程序设计一个跨平台map编辑器,但我不确定在语言/GUI库选择方面应该采取什么方法。只是为了一些基本信息,编辑器需要解析和输出xml文件。我最熟悉C++、Lua和Perl,但我也愿意使用Python(可以练习)。为了提高工作效率,我更喜欢用脚本语言来完成。感谢任何建议,谢谢。我还希望支持填写表格等。附言我已经测试过扩展现有的map编辑器,但这并不值得,因为它们没有提供我在基本层面上需要的功能,无论如何我都需要重写整个东西。 最佳答案 我的偏好总是Gtk2和Perl5,但这种组合在Linux上效果最好。您将在什么操